About Magill 5072

The size of Magill is approximately 3.5 square kilometres. It has 18 parks covering nearly 6.4% of total area. The population of Magill in 2011 was 8,229 people. By 2016 the population was 8,845 showing a population growth of 7.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Magill is 30-39 years. Households in Magill are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Magill work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 63.3% of the homes in Magill were owner-occupied compared with 65.1% in 2016.

Magill has 4,894 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Magill have seen a 75.29%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 60.99% increase. As at 30 September 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Magill is $1,150,474 while the median value for Units is $608,468.
  • Houses have a median rent of $625 while Units have a median rent of $485.
There are currently 14 properties listed for sale, and 5 properties listed for rent in Magill on OnTheHouse. According to CoreLogic's data, 212 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Magill.
